Members of the Northern Ohio Violent Fugitive Task Force have made a second arrested in the murder of 22-year-old Gaven Carlisle.

The NOVTF arrested Tequan Franklin, 22 in the Cleveland. Franklin was wanted by the New Philadelphia Police Department for complicity to commit murder.

Frankin and Sajjaad Butler, 19, are accused in the shooting death of Carlisle on March 5. According to police, Franklin and Butler met Carlisle at an address near the 600 block of 11th Drive NW to do a drug deal and Carlisle ended up being shot and killed. Butler was arrested later that day.

Task force members tracked Franklin to the Cleveland area Thursday afternoon after receiving information he fled the Canton area. He was arrested while in a vehicle outside a convenient store near the 3900 block of Warrensville Center Road, Warrensville Heights, Ohio.

“The successful arrest of this violent fugitive was due to the strong partnerships between local law enforcement and the US Marshals Service in northern Ohio,” said U.S. Marshal Pete Elliott.
